Paraglider pilot rescued after Lake District crash

Patterdale Mountain Rescueteam were called on Friday afternoon by the police to attend to a 68-year-old  paraglider pilot who had crashed below Arthur’s Pike above Ullswater.
The man crashed onto a rocky outcrop and fractured his collarbone. The team secured the area and prepared the casualty for a stretcher lift into a RAF Sea King from 
Leconfield which  flew the casualty to the Cumberland nfirmary Carlisle
